In a new era, glucose sensors straddle the line between medical device and wellness tool

The continuous glucose monitor (CGM) market is rapidly expanding beyond traditional diabetes management into general wellness and weight loss, driven by over-the-counter availability from Dexcom and Abbott. This market shift is intensifying regulatory scrutiny, as evidenced by Dexcom Ventures-backed Signos receiving FDA clearance for its app as a medical device for weight management when used with Dexcom's Stelo CGM. This approval sets a significant precedent for other digital health apps, signaling a stricter regulatory environment for products previously claiming 'general wellness' and highlighting the growing market potential for wearables in chronic disease prevention, despite ongoing questions about efficacy and potential misuse.

The continuous glucose monitor (CGM) market is undergoing a significant expansion from its core diabetes management application into the broader consumer wellness and weight loss sector, a shift catalyzed by the over-the-counter availability of devices from Dexcom (DXCM) and Abbott (ABT). This evolution is creating a complex regulatory landscape, highlighted by the FDA's clearance of the Signos app, backed by Dexcom Ventures, as a medical device for weight management. This clearance sets a critical precedent, signaling that the FDA is prepared to scrutinize 'general wellness' claims and may expect similar apps from competitors like Levels and Nutrisense to undergo formal review. Dexcom is strategically positioned, not only as a hardware provider with its Stelo CGM but also as an ecosystem enabler, directly supporting partners through the costly FDA approval process. While this creates a substantial growth opportunity, the market faces headwinds from a lack of scientific consensus on optimal glucose ranges for non-diabetics and concerns about potential user harm, which could temper long-term adoption and introduce liability risks.
